Is there no end to Rio's cycle of violence?

  • 9 years ago
Since it won the right to host the 2016 Olympic Games, Rio de Janeiro has been working to secure its violent slums. But that's been overshadowed by frequent blunders by police. In the last five years, the Brazilian police have killed more civilians than their American counterparts have in three decades. And as our reporters found out, the officers pay a heavy price too, with more than 100 police officers killed every year in Rio alone.
